The use of fast or turbo spin echo FSE, TSE imaging has become routine in MRI today. A spin echo sequence employs a 180#176; RF pulse typically to create the echo, which also corrects for dephasing effects from slight field inhomogeneities and chemical shift. FIGURE 22-4 The fast spin echo sequence is shown. In this rapid scan, several echoes are recalled, with each one contributing to a different line of k-space. For each echo recalled, a separate 180-degree refocusing pulse is applied in conjuction with the slice selection gradients. Although the reduction in measurement time using fast spin echo FSE technique is desirable and plays a fundamental role in clinical imaging today, the very use of multiple closely spaced refocusing pulses is associated with higher RF power deposition.

Oblique coronal dualecho CSE and FSE T2W images with fat. To understand how rapid the fast spin-echo sequence is, we should review how data is obtained in the conventional spin-echo. A 90o excitation pulse is followed by a 180o rephasing pulse. Only one encoding phase step is applied by T R in each section and just one K-space line is completed by T R [10,12,13]. Fast spin echo images are more T2 weighted, which makes it difficult to obtain true proton density weighted images. For dual echo imaging with density weighting, the TR should be kept between 2000 - 2400 msec with a short ETL e.g., 4. Other terms for this technique are: Turbo Spin Echo Rapid Imaging Spin Echo, Rapid Spin Echo, Rapid Acquisition Spin Echo, Rapid Acquisition with Refocused Echoes.
